016 An excellent spring of water a little to the South of the Free Church, an old established name. This well was dug by a man named Andrew hence the name.

016 A plain stone building erected in 1843 at a cost of about £880. The interior is well fitted up with galleries etc, sufficiently commodious with sittings about 650. The present Congregation is about 600 Communicants about 400. The Minister is the Rev[Reverend] Robert Kinnear whose stipend amounts to about £170 paid by the sustentation fund.
